  • Speed
    StackBlitz is known for its quick load times and fast editing capabilities, making it ideal for rapid development and testing.
  • Ease of Use
    The interface is intuitive and user-friendly, allowing developers to get started quickly without a steep learning curve.
  • Zero-Setup
    Users can write, compile, and run code directly in the browser without any setup or configuration required.
  • Integrations
    StackBlitz integrates seamlessly with GitHub, allowing for easy import and export of repositories.
  • WebContainers
    StackBlitz uses WebContainers to run Node.js applications in the browser, providing a near-native development experience.
  • Collaboration
    Real-time collaboration features allow multiple users to work on the same project simultaneously, similar to Google Docs.

Possible disadvantages

  • Limited Plugins
    Unlike traditional IDEs like VSCode or IntelliJ, StackBlitz has a limited ecosystem of plugins and extensions.
  • Online Dependency
    StackBlitz requires an internet connection to function, which can be a limitation for developers who need to work offline.
  • Performance
    For very large projects or those requiring extensive computational resources, performance may degrade compared to local development environments.
  • Mobile Accessibility
    While StackBlitz is accessible on mobile devices, the user experience is not as optimized as it is on desktop browsers.
  • Limited Framework Support
    Although StackBlitz supports many popular frameworks, it doesn't support all frameworks or versions, which could be limiting for some projects.
  • Storage and Persistence
    Files and data are stored in the cloud, which might raise concerns around data privacy and persistence for some users.

Overall verdict

  • Overall, airfocus is highly regarded as an efficient and effective tool for product managers and teams looking to enhance their priority setting and roadmapping processes. Its flexibility and ease of use are often highlighted as major strengths.

Why this product is good

  • airfocus is considered a good product management tool because it offers a user-friendly interface, robust prioritization frameworks, and custom roadmapping features. It integrates well with various other productivity and development tools, making it versatile for teams. Additionally, its ability to consolidate feedback and allow for collaborative planning makes it a strong choice for teams looking to streamline their product management processes.

Recommended for

    airfocus is recommended for product managers, project managers, and cross-functional teams looking to improve their decision-making processes and organize their strategic planning more effectively. It's especially useful for teams that require collaboration across different departments and need to maintain clear communication of priorities and progress.
